Due to the demands of her father's work, Kari Townsend moved 13 times in 12 years as a child.
Once co-hosted and co-chaired a dinner for royalty and 350 VIPs.
Kari Townsend dedicated 10% of all profits from her first CD release, "Postcard Blue" to Performers for Literacy, an organization that uses performing artists to promote literacy to children.
Lived in Franklin, Tennessee (outside of Nashville) and in Santa Fe, New Mexico.
As a PhD candidate, Kari explored twentieth century scholarly interpretations of embodiment in Samuel Beckett's later works.
